0

khái niệm cấu trúc dữ liệu stack

CẤU TRÚC DỮ LIỆU STACK VÀ ỨNG DỤNG CỦA STACXK TRONG CÁC GIẢI THUẬT ĐỆ QUY.DOC

CẤU TRÚC DỮ LIỆU STACK VÀ ỨNG DỤNG CỦA STACXK TRONG CÁC GIẢI THUẬT ĐỆ QUY.DOC

Công nghệ thông tin

... động của stack và ứng dụng của stack trong các giải thuật đệ qui.III. ĐỐI TƯỢNG NGHIÊN CỨU• Lí thuyết về cấu trúc dữ liệu trừu tượng Stack • Hoạt động của Stack và việc áp dụng stack trong ... định nghĩa khác là: ngăn xếp (stack) là một cấu trúc dữ liệu trừu tượng làm việc theo nguyên lý vào sau ra trước (last in first out).Một ngăn xếp là một cấu trúc dữ liệu dạng thùng chứa (container) ... dàng.Chính vì vậy mà trong chương trình học môn cấu trúc dữ liệu và giải thuật của các trường cao đẳng, đại học hay trường chuyên, kiểu cấu trúc dữ liệu stack và đệ qui chiếm một vị trí quan trọng,...
  • 32
  • 4,055
  • 24
Cấu trúc dữ liệu Stack pptx

Cấu trúc dữ liệu Stack pptx

Cơ sở dữ liệu

... stack) {return stack. top == 1;}full(StackType stack) {return stack. top == Max;}push(Eltype el, StackType *stack) {if (full( *stack) )printf( stack tràn”);else ( *stack) .storage[( *stack) .top++]=el;}Eltype ... mảng của Stack (stack. c)Initialize(StackType stack) {top=0;}empty(StackType stack) {return top == 0;}full(StackType stack) {return top == Max;}push(Eltype el, StackType stack) {if ... Eltype.•int top;•void Initialize(StackType stack) ;•int empty(StackType stack) ;•int full(StackType stack) ;•void push(Eltype el, StackType stack) ;•Eltype pop(StackType stack) ;...
  • 45
  • 393
  • 0
cấu trúc dữ liệu và giải thuật stack

cấu trúc dữ liệu và giải thuật stack

Tin học

... liên kếtType Stack = ^cell;Cell = record Infor: Item; Next: Stack; End;Var S: Stack; anSan-1a1 Procedure POP(Var S : Stack; Var X : Item; Var OK : Boolean);Var P : Stack; Begin ... rỗng.Function empty (var s: stack) :boolean;3 kiểm tra ngăn xếp đầyFunction full (var s: stack) :boolean;4 Thêm một phần tử x vào đỉnh của ngăn xếpProcedure push(x: Item, var s: stack) 5 Loại phần tử ... giá trị của phần tử này cho xProcedure pop(var s: stack, var x: item); Procedure PUSH(Var S : Stack; X : Item, Var ok : boolean);Var P : Stack; Begin New(P); P^.Info := X; p^.Next := S;...
  • 15
  • 462
  • 2
Unit chứa khai báo các cấu trúc dữ liệu cho đồ thị và cài đặt thủ tục tìm đường đi ngắn nhất theo thuật toán

Unit chứa khai báo các cấu trúc dữ liệu cho đồ thị và cài đặt thủ tục tìm đường đi ngắn nhất theo thuật toán

Kỹ thuật lập trình

... T:TJpegimage;beginSaveDialog1.DefaultExt:='*.JPG';156PHẦN PHỤ LỤCPhụ lục 1Unit chứa khai báo các cấu trúc dữ liệu cho đồ thịvà cài đặt thủ tục tìm đường đi ngắn nhất theo thuật toánunit Func_DoThi;interfacetype...
  • 23
  • 641
  • 1
Tài liệu Kỹ thuật lập trình - Chương 4: Khái quát về cấu trúc dữ liệu doc

Tài liệu Kỹ thuật lập trình - Chương 4: Khái quát về cấu trúc dữ liệu doc

Kỹ thuật lập trình

... 4: Khái quát về cấutrúcdữ liệu Xóa bớtdữ liệu Dữ liệuA Dữ liệuB Dữ liệuX Dữ liệuY0x00 Dữ liệuCpHead Dữ liệuA Dữ liệuBXóa dữ liệu ₫ầudanhsách Dữ liệuC Dữ liệuX Dữ liệuY0x00pHeadXóa dữ liệugiữadanhsách16© ... 4: Khái quát về cấutrúcdữ liệu Danh sách móc nối (linked list) Dữ liệuA Dữ liệuB Dữ liệuX Dữ liệuY0x00 Dữ liệuCpHeadItem AItem BItem CItem XItem Y7© 2004, HOÀNG MINH SƠNChương 4: Khái ... biểudiễndữ liệu: ₫ịnh nghĩakiểudữliệumớisử dụng cấu trúc (struct, class, union, )18© 2004, HOÀNG MINH SƠNChương 4: Khái quát về cấutrúcdữ liệu Định nghĩacấutrúcVector Tên file: vector.h Cấutrúcdữ...
  • 32
  • 917
  • 1
Tài liệu Giáo trình cấu trúc dữ liệu và giải thuật_Chương 3: Cấu trúc Stack & Queue pptx

Tài liệu Giáo trình cấu trúc dữ liệu và giải thuật_Chương 3: Cấu trúc Stack & Queue pptx

Kỹ thuật lập trình

... rong”);return;}Trang: 12Giáo trình Cấu trúc dữ liệu và thuật giải Chương 3: Cấu trúc Stack Chương 3CẤU TRÚC STACK & QUEUE1. GIỚI THIỆU VỀ STACK 1.1 Khái niệm về stack Stack có thể được xem là một ... 263.5Trang: 18Giáo trình Cấu trúc dữ liệu và thuật giải Chương 3: Cấu trúc Stack Dữ liệu xuất: TRUE|FALSE.• Tác vụ pushChức năng: thêm nút mới tại đỉnh stack. Dữ liệu nhập: nút mới Dữ liệu xuất: không.• ... lấy ra trước nên cấu trúc hàng đợi còn được gọi là cấu trúc FIFO( First In FirstOut).Trang: 8Giáo trình Cấu trúc dữ liệu và thuật giải Chương 3: Cấu trúc Stack void main(){ STACK s;int coso,so,sodu;...
  • 18
  • 788
  • 3
Bài giảng kỹ thuật lập trình_Chương 4: Khái quát về cấu trúc dữ liệu potx

Bài giảng kỹ thuật lập trình_Chương 4: Khái quát về cấu trúc dữ liệu potx

Kỹ thuật lập trình

... SƠNChương 4: Khái quát về cấutrúcdữ liệu © 2005 - HMSXóa bớtdữ liệu Xóa dữ liệu ₫ầu danh sách Dữ liệuA Dữ liệuB Dữ liệuX Dữ liệuY0x00 Dữ liệuCpHead Dữ liệuC Dữ liệuA Dữ liệuB Dữ liệuX Dữ liệuY0x00pHeadXóa ... SƠNChương 4: Khái quát về cấutrúcdữ liệu © 2005 - HMSCác cấutrúcdữ liệu thông dụng Mảng (nghĩarộng): Tậphợpcácdữ liệucóthể truynhậptùyý theochỉ số Danh sách (list): Tậphợpcácdữ liệu ₫ược móc ... liệu: ₫ịnh nghĩakiểudữliệumớisử dụng cấu trúc (struct, class, union, )4.1 Giớithiệuchung8© 2004, HOÀNG MINH SƠNChương 4: Khái quát về cấutrúcdữ liệu © 2005 - HMSCác cấutrúcdữ liệu thông dụng...
  • 32
  • 486
  • 0
Tài liệu cấu trúc dữ liệu

Tài liệu cấu trúc dữ liệu

Kỹ thuật lập trình

... chia, Div, Mod… Kiểu dữ liệu có hai loại là kiểu dữ liệu sơ cấp và kiểu dữ liệucấu trúc hay còn gọi là cấu trúc dữ liệu. Kiểu dữ liệu sơ cấp là kiểu dữ liệu mà giá trị dữ liệu của nó là đơn ... Kiểu dữ liệucấu trúc hay còn gọi là cấu trúc dữ liệu là kiểu dữ liệu mà giá trị dữ liệu của nó là sự kết hợp của các giá trị khác. Ví dụ: ARRAY là một cấu trúc dữ liệu. Một kiểu dữ liệu ... một bài toán thực tế. 2. Hiểu rõ khái niệm về kiểu dữ liệu, kiểu dữ liệu trừu tượng và cấu trúc dữ liệu. Trang 21 Cấu trúc dữ liệu Chương II: Các kiểu dữ liệu trừu tượng cơ bản Hình II.3...
  • 151
  • 1,268
  • 6
Giáo trình cấu trúc dữ liệu và giải thuật

Giáo trình cấu trúc dữ liệu và giải thuật

Kỹ thuật lập trình

... đáng với cấu trúc luận lý này. • Lý do thứ ba là để duy trì tính nhất quán với các cấu trúc dữ liệu khác cũng như các cách hiện thực khác nhau của một cấu trúc dữ liệu: một cấu trúc dữ liệu bao ... phải có để lưu dữ liệu. Chương 2 – Ngăn xếp Giáo trình Cấu trúc dữ liệu và Giải thuật 20Phương thức thêm một phần tử dữ liệu vào ngăn xếp: template <class Entry> ErrorCode Stack& lt;Entry>::push(const ... kiểu T. 1.4.4. Các kiểu dữ liệu trừu tượng Định nghóa: CTDL (Data Structure) là một sự kết hợp của các kiểu dữ liệu nguyên tố, và/ hoặc các kiểu dữ liệucấu trúc, và/ hoặc các CTDL khác...
  • 426
  • 3,688
  • 59
Bài giảng cấu trúc dữ liệu

Bài giảng cấu trúc dữ liệu

Kỹ thuật lập trình

... Inc - 1997 Cấu Trúc Dữ Liệu + Thuật Toán = Chương Trình, người dịch Nguyễn Quốc Cường, NXB Đại Học vàGiáo dục chuyên nghiệp.8Câu hỏi và thảo luậnThông tin môn học• CẤU TRÚC DỮ LIỆU 1• Số ... thuật liên quan đến dữ liệu. •Hiểu được tầm quan trọng của giải thuật vàcách tổ chức dữ liệu. •Nắm được các phương pháp tổ chức và các thao tác cơ sở trên từng cấu trúc dữ liệu. • Hình thành ... Tài liệu tham khảo• Nhập môn Cấu Trúc Dữ Liệu và Thuật Toán, tác giả:– PGS.TS. Dương Anh Đức– ThS. Trần Hạnh Nhi•...
  • 4
  • 942
  • 8

Xem thêm